How to see it

HIP 23387 has a visual magnitude of about 8.17: it usually needs binoculars or a small telescope, especially from light-polluted sites.

Sky position

Equatorial coordinates for HIP 23387: right ascension 5h 1m 39s, declination +37° 24′ 34″ (J2000), in the region of the Auriga constellation (IAU figure Aur).
